Output 67da81186340428d9648fbaa139366fe24d4e7ec3b4e2ae152ce99f9fd37fcaf:12

value
147356073
script pubkey
OP_0 OP_PUSHBYTES_32 3524748ee8db3f91b1559e06368a61b5aa37a9a10b2650979d4c7f4e60ac3214
address
bc1qx5j8frhgmvlerv24ncrrdznpkk4r02dppvn9p9uaf3l5uc9vxg2q3teust
transaction
67da81186340428d9648fbaa139366fe24d4e7ec3b4e2ae152ce99f9fd37fcaf
confirmations
145714
spent
true